Baked Pork Chops with Potatoes

Ingredients
5 pork chops, 1/2 - 3/4 inch thick
1/4 cup diced onion
1 can cream of celery soup (or cream of mushroom or chicken)
1/2 cup milk
4-5 medium potatoes, sliced
1/4 cup flour
1 1/2 tsp. salt
1/4 tsp. pepper

Preheat oven to 350 degrees.  Brown pork chops in skillet on medium high heat.  Remove pork from skillet and set aside.   Combine soup, milk, and onion and pour into hot skillet.   Quickly add flour and blend, stirring quickly.  Remove from heat.

In the bottom of a greased casserole dish, layer sliced potatoes.  Pour half of the soup mixture over the potatoes.   Place browned pork chops on mixture.   Cover with remaining soup mixture.   Cover and bake for 1 1/4 hours.  Serves 5.
